Responsibilities
Prepares, issues, and administers all Purchase Orders for selected suppliers
Monitors and expedites purchased materials to ensure timely delivery of product to support customer requirements. Reviews alternative supplier options, revisions to support production.
Reports daily on critical items required for production.
Timely escalation of critical items not supporting and industry wide challenges.
Communicates critical items with Production Planning and Co-ordinating team.
Applies advanced planning and forecasting skills to ensure future on time deliveries.
Analyzes material requirements and / or Kanban levels for purchased parts to achieve optimum material flow.
Monitors and expedites materials to ensure material flow to support production requirements and sales orders.
Establishes order parameters to optimize inventory levels to improve flow.
Develops and manages effective relationships with internal departments. . engineering, marketing, customer service, manufacturing, accounting, planning / materials, and quality.
Maintains strong working relationships with suppliers.
Maintains Material Requirements Planning (MRP) order parameters on assigned parts (. lead time, Minimum Order Quantity (MOQ), Multiples, Contact info in MHICA system.

About Us
MHI Canada Aerospace, Inc. (MHICA), a group company of Mitsubishi Heavy Industries, is a Tier 1 manufacturer of major aircraft structures and assemblies, based in Mississauga, Ontario.
Over the past decade, MHICA has built more than aircraft components, it has built a recognized worldwide reputation for capacity, precision, on-time delivery and excellence. MHICA has two state-of-the-art facilities combined to 476,000 sq. ft. This comprises of Manufacturing & Assembly, Engineering, Quality and Supply Chain, where more than 800 highly-skilled employees are working on Bombardier's sector-leading Global 5000 / 6000 and Challenger 350 business aircraft. MHICA's technicians build and join wing assemblies and fuselage sections, as well as perform systems and flight control assembly installations and testing.
